Output 83faf0150879490c76012129785983b280b02342cd6cdc629b01a7dc03bd7973:0

value
10100
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 39acaef1fc4755f85fff831af1f1471f1e989e1d OP_EQUALVERIFY OP_CHECKSIG
address
16FxPBnQu5aw8FsQBfy1XmZ3dfsN81LVk6
transaction
83faf0150879490c76012129785983b280b02342cd6cdc629b01a7dc03bd7973
spent
true